Reetika Hooda loses quarterfinal in 76 kg wrestling at Paris Olympics

Photo: SAI Media
Reetika Hooda lost to top seed Aiperi Medet Kyzy by 1-1 in 76 kg women's freestyle quarterfinal.

After a strong start at the Paris Olympics, Reetika Hooda lost her quarterfinal match against Aiperi Medet Kyzy of Kyrgyzstan in the 76kg wrestling match. Now, Reetika must wait for the repechage round; she will only have the opportunity to compete for bronze if Aiperi Medet Kyzy reaches the semifinals.

The match began on an aggressive note, with both wrestlers focusing on defence. For the first minute, both grapplers attempted to defend without much attacking action. The Indian, in a blue jersey, and Aiperi received passivity warnings for not being aggressive enough. Due to the passivity warning, Aiperi was given 30 seconds to attack, but she failed to do so, awarding Reetika one point as Aiperi did not make a successful attack in the first round.

In the second round, Reetika received a passivity warning, losing a point. Aiperi then tried to take control of the bout by moving around the Indians. With the passivity point awarded to Aiperi in the second round, the referee declared her the winner.
